For example, a plc may control the flow of cooling water through part of an industrial process, but the scada system may allow operators to change the set points for the flow, and enable alarm conditions, such as loss of flow and high temperature, to be displayed and recorded.

Supervisory control and data acquisition scada, is a software networked to industrial devices like a plc, providing a predesignated limited level of control and collecting data from those devices.
